【Redis基础-主从库模式】教程文章相关的互联网学习教程文章

Redis的基础知识【图】

文章目录 Redis的基础知识一些基本命令Redis的执行效率为什么那么快?以及为什么Redis是单线程的?Redis的基础知识 一些基本命令 redis默认有16个数据库,在redis.conf配置文件中可以看到,如下图:默认使用的是第0个,可以使用select切换数据库!如下图:set命令可以存储键格式set key value,get命令可以取出指定的键对应的值格式get key,如下图:dbsize命令可以查看当前数据库的大小,也即是当前数据库里面存放了多少条数据,如...

Redis基础

1. 概述 Redis: REmote DIctionary Server。是一个Key - Value 型的缓存产品。 可以用来干什么?内存存储和持久化: redis支持异步将内存中的数据写到硬盘上,同时不影响继续服务。 取最新N个数据的操作,如:可以将最新的10条评论的ID放在Redis的List集合里面。 模拟类似于HttpSession这种需要设定过期时间的功能。 发布、订阅消息系统 定时器、计数器 Redis6之前是单线程执行的,6之后支持IO的多线程。默认有16个数据库,类似数...

Redis基础(思维导图)附Redis工具类【图】

Redis 1、什么是Redis NoSql数据库分布式缓存中间件key-value存储提供海量数据存储访问数据存储在内存里,读取更快 2、缓存方案对比 缓存方案优点缺点Ehcache 基于Java开发基于JVM缓存简单、轻巧、方便 集群不支持(缓存不共享)分布式不支持 Memcache 简单的key-value存储(单一String类型)内存使用率比较高多核处理,多线程 无法容灾无法持久化 Redis 丰富的数据结构持久化主从同步、故障转移内存数据库 单线程(6.0加入多线程)单核...

Redis核心技术与实战:(一)基础架构【图】

01 基本架构:一个键值数据库应该包含什么? 我们想构造一个简单的键值数据库SimpleKV,它的基础架构是什么样的?首先放出作者设计的简单的键值数据库SimpleKV与redis架构的对比图,你想造的KV数据库是什么样的,这样可以更好的理解redis的基本架构。 大体来说,一个键值数据库包括了访问框架、索引模块、操作模块、存储模块四部分。开始构造SimpleKV时,首先就要考虑里面可以存什么样的数据,可以对数据进行什么样的操作,也就是数...

2021年互联网大厂Java面试清单:ZK+Redis+MySQL+Java基础+架构【图】

多数的公司总体上面试都是以自我介绍+项目介绍+项目细节/难点提问+基础知识点考核+算法题这个流程下来的。有些公司可能还会问几个实际的场景类的问题,这个环节阿里是必问的,这种问题通常是没有正确答案的,就看个人的理解,个人的积累了。剩下的就没啥了,都是换汤不换药,聊项目就看你自己对你自己的项目是否理解的透彻,比如经常问你你为什么选择这个技术,为什么这么处理之类的,常考的基础的知识点就那么多,最后算法就是靠刷...

Redis基础及数据类型

Redis是什么 Redis(Remote Dictionary Server):远程字典服务是一个开源的使用C语言编写、支持网络、可基于内存亦可持久化的日志型、key-Value数据库,提供有多种语言的API当下最热门的NoSQL技术之一,也被人们称之为结构化数据库 Redis能干什么 内存存储、持久化(内存中是断电即失,所以持久化很重要)效率高,可以用于高速缓存发布订阅系统地图信息分析计时器、计数器、浏览量 Redis的特性 多样的数据类型可以持久化事务功能可...

【2021】Java零基础 JavaEE高级/javaweb/数据库/ssm框架/maven/linux 哈米在线音乐Java互联网实战项目 大型分布式ssm+redis+dubbo+zookee【图】

【2021】Java零基础 JavaEE高级/javaweb/数据库/ssm框架/maven/linux 哈米在线音乐Java互联网实战项目 大型分布式ssm+redis+dubbo+zookee 大数据 Java互联网架构师之路/微服务/高性能/分布式/底层源码/高并发 Java互联网架构师之路/微服务/高性能/分布式/底层源码/高并发 系统架构为前后端分离,前端模块采用VuenodeisElementUl后端使用前沿技术 SpringcloudAlibaba作为配置中心,注册中心微服务,业务模块为商品微服务,单品页...

redis 基础指令

字符串操作: 一个键一个值 set get del 设置\获取\删除变量 incr\decr ++\-- mset\mget 多个设置\获取操作 type key 查看类型 append key1 value 向key1后面链接一个值 哈希操作: 多个键多个值 hset key field value 向key 里添加键值对 hget key field 获取键值对的值 hlen key 查看key键值对的个数 hgetall key 查看key里的所有键值对 hexists key field 检查key里是否有field这个键 列表操作: 一个键多个值 列表中可以左操作也...

redis 基础(二) Redis安装【代码】【图】

1安装reids 1.1Linux(centos7)安装Redis进入官网通过Xftp 6,将其移动到linux下,然后解压 tar -zxvf redis-6.0.9.tar .gz #tar -zxvf reids文件名称进入redis文件夹安装redis之前需要安装一个依赖: yum install gcc-c++开始安装reids 先进行编辑:make然后安装:make install配置reids 先进入redis的utils文件夹下然后拷贝redis的启动脚本,拷贝到/etc/init.d/文件夹下:cp redis_init_script /etc/init.d/ 再把redis文件夹下的red...

redis 基础(一) 初步了解redis【图】

1缓存相关 1.1缓存穿透 问题:查询的key再redis中不存在,对应的id在数据库也不存在。此时被非法用户进行攻击,大量的请求会去数据库(DB)造成宕机,从而影响整个系统。这种现象称之为 缓存穿透; 解决方法:缓存redis把空的数据也缓存到redis中,比如空字符串,空对象等; 1.2缓存雪崩 在高并发下,大量缓存key在同一时间失效,大量请求直接落在数据库上,导致数据库宕机。 缓存雪崩一般只能缓解,不能杜绝; 解决方式:缓存永不过...

Redis基础【代码】【图】

第一章 Redis基础 课程计划1. Redis 入 门 (了解) (操作)2. 数据类型 (重点) (操作) (理解)3. 常用指令(操作)4. Jedis (重点) (操作)5. 持 久 化 (重点)(理解)6. 数据删除与淘汰策略(理解)7. 主从复制 (重点) (操作) (理解)8. 哨 兵 (重点) (操作) (理解)9. Cluster集群方案 (重点) (操作) (理解)10. 企业级缓存解决方案 (重点)(理解)11. 性能指标监控 (了解)NoSQL的概念,redis的应...

Redis---基础知识:数据类型、持久化机制、虚拟内存、高级特性、应用场景

文章目录 1.redis的数据类型2.详解Redis 的持久化机制--RDB和AOF3.redis核心概念4.Redis 单key值过大 优化方式5.Redis的缓存穿透、缓存击穿、缓存雪崩6.redis之虚拟内存7.redis高级特性8.redis的应用场景1.redis的数据类型 Redis学习笔记整理(黑马程序员视频课程)2.详解Redis 的持久化机制–RDB和AOF 详解Redis 的持久化机制–RDB和AOF3.redis核心概念 Redis核心概念4.Redis 单key值过大 优化方式 Redis 单key值过大 优化方式5.R...

Redis-第四章节-基础知识

基础知识 5种基本数据类型 String(字符串)String是redis最基本的数据类型,一个key对应一个value。 String类型的值最大能存储512M。Hash(哈希)Hash相当于双重map。 每个Hash可以存储40多亿键值对。List(列表)redis列表是简单的字符串列表。 每个列表可以存储40多亿元素。Set(无序集合)每个集合可以存储40多亿元素。zSet(有序集合) 服务器操作命令 描述bgrewriteaof 异步执行一个AOF文件重写操作bgsave 在后台异步保存当前...

整合篇:零基础学习与使用Redis【代码】【图】

目录 1、创建工程2、开启软件3、修改配置4、测试操作配套资料,免费下载 链接:https://pan.baidu.com/s/1jA217UgqXpONi_fV-aOzqw 提取码:bm2g 复制这段内容后打开百度网盘手机App,操作更方便哦注意:学习Redis请参考我的另外一篇文章:https://caochenlei.blog.csdn.net/article/details/1080679291、创建工程2、开启软件 下载配套资料,点击 startup.bat 启动软件即可。 3、修改配置 spring:redis:host: 127.0.0.1port: 6379pa...

Redis基础篇(五)AOF与RDB比较和选择策略

RDB和AOF对比 关于RDB和AOF的优缺点,官网上面也给了比较详细的说明redis.io/topics/pers… RDB 优点: RDB快照是一个压缩过的非常紧凑的文件,保存着某个时间点的数据集,适合做数据的备份,灾难恢复;可以最大化Redis的的性能,在保存RDB文件,服务器进程只需要fork一个子进程来完成RDB文件的创建,父进程不需要做IO操作;与AOF相比,恢复大数据集的时候会更快; 缺点: RDB的数据安全性是不如AOF的,保存整个数据集的过程是比繁...